According to Deadline, James Gunn is back at work putting together his Superman: Legacy cast, with Venezuelan actress María Gabriela de Faría (Animal Control) set to play Angela Spica/The Engineer.

In the comics, Angie Spica is the second Engineer, and a member of the Authority. She has a liquid body due to nanites in her bloodstream, and with this metal blood, she can create solid objects. The character was created by Warren Ellis and Bryan Hitch, and first appeared in The Authority #1 in 1999.

De Faría is a rising star who recently appeared in The Exorcism of God. She’s also starred in The Moodys and Deadly Class, a well-received Image Comics adaptation executive produced by the Russo Brothers.

Superman: Legacy tells the story of Superman's journey to reconcile his Kryptonian heritage with his human upbringing as Clark Kent of Smallville, Kansas. He is the embodiment of truth, justice and the American way, guided by human kindness in a world that sees kindness as old-fashioned.

David Corenswet is playing the Man of Steel, while Rachel Brosnahan has been tapped to star as Lois Lane. other recent casting additions include Isabela Merced as Hawkgirl, Edi Gathegi as Mister Terrific, Nathan Fillion as Guy Gardner, and Anthony Carrigan as Metamorpho.

Skyler Gisondo is rumoured to be playing Jimmy Olsen and we recently learned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 2 star Kurt Russell may be in the running for Jor-El.

Superman: Legacy is currently set to be released in theaters on July 11. 2025.
